Uzbekistan intend to abolish corporate income tax, reduce VAT rate
Tashkent, Uzbekistan (UzDaily.com) -- A draft concept for reforming the tax system has been published in Uzbekistan.

The document says that the transition to medium-term tax planning and strengthening of guarantees of stability of the tax legislation, increasing investment attractiveness of the republic is one of the key priorities of reforming the tax system.

One of the key priorities is to reduce the level of tax burden on business entities, eliminate imbalances in the level of tax burden between large and small businesses.

Uzbekistan also plans to optimize the number of taxes by unifying and combining taxes, which have a similar tax base, as well as reducing and simplifying tax reporting, and minimizing operating expenses.

In particular, the concept proposes to abolish the corporate profit tax (with the exception of commercial banks and insurance organizations), with the establishment of the procedure according to which businesses will pay dividend tax at a rate of 25%. The tax will be paid only paid dividends.

It is also proposed to reduce the VAT tax rate from 20 to 12%, with the extension of the obligation to pay it to all categories of taxpayers, including individual entrepreneurs with turnover of over 1 billion soums, and creation of a full tax offset system, the specification of the taxable base.

There will be no VAT payments on sales of agricultural products and certain food products produced in the republic, in order to prevent the growth of prices for them.

The authors of the concept also propose to carry out an inventory and cancel ineffective benefits for the payment of VAT, including import of goods.

The concept proposes to abolish all compulsory payments levied in state trust funds from the turnover (proceeds) of legal entities.

The document also proposes to combine the tax on personal income, unified social payments and insurance premiums of citizens to the non-budgetary Pension Fund under the Ministry of Finance of the Republic of Uzbekistan in a single tax on personal income with a flat scale of taxation of 25%.

According to the document, the system of simplified taxation procedure will also be abolished.

Uzbekistan intends to introduce a system, in line with which small businesses are legal entities, which have an annual turnover less than 1 billion soums: they are not VAT payers and pay a turnover tax (revenue) of 5%.

It is proposed to reduce the tax burden for property tax of legal entities by gradually reducing the rate (in 2019 to 2.5% and to 2021 to 1%) and excluding objects of taxation of industrial buildings and structures.

In stages, the types and rates of excise tax on the excisable goods produced in the Republic of Uzbekistan and imported excisable goods will be unified, and types of excise tax will be reduced.

The concept also suggests measures to reform the tax administration system in Uzbekistan.
